The former Jesuit Residence in Neustadt an der Weinstraße is a historic monastic building located in Rhineland-Palatinate. It represents the presence of the Jesuit order in this region and stands as a testament to the city's religious and architectural evolution.

History+

Founded by the Jesuit order, the residence served for centuries as an important base for the order's activities. Its history is closely intertwined with the development of Neustadt an der Weinstraße and the wider region, playing a role in education and pastoral care.

Location+

The monastery is situated within the city of Neustadt an der Weinstraße, which is located in the federal state of Rhineland-Palatinate, Germany. The city is renowned for its picturesque setting at the edge of the Palatinate Forest and its winemaking tradition.

On site+

Today, the former Jesuit Residence remains an integral part of the urban landscape of Neustadt an der Weinstraße. Its historical significance is still evident, contributing to the city's cultural identity.
